NE Ross Street Closures: Stormwater Improvement Project
The section of Northeast Ross Street, from NE 15th Avenue to Main Street/Highway 99, will be closed to through-traffic daily from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m., July 10 through the end of October. The daily closures are needed for crews to safely construct and install stormwater improvements to help treat pollution from the roadway and enhance water quality in Burnt Bridge Creek. Northeast North Road into the Bonneville Power Administration (BPA) complex will remain open for BPA access only.
Devine Road: Pedestrian and Bicycle Safety Improvement Project
Construction began in late October for pedestrian and bicycle enhancements along North Devine Road, between Idaho Street and the Burnt Bridge Creek Trail crossing. Crews will replace the existing path along the west side of Devine Road, from Idaho Street to the Burnt Bridge Creek trail, with a wider ADA-compliant, multi-use path for walkers and bike riders. Project completion is anticipated for late May 2023, weather and construction conditions allowing.
SE 1st Street Improvement Project: SE 1st Street, 164th Avenue to 177th Avenue
Construction on the first segment of the SE 1st Street Improvement Project, 164th Avenue to 177th Avenue, started in early December 2021. This long-awaited transportation improvement project will provide a complete urban street system with sidewalks, bike facilities, stormwater enhancements, street lights and sound walls where designated. Contractor crews are wrapping up with final landscaping, sidewalk work and completing the sound wall. Final pavement striping will be installed when the weather is warmer, drier and more favorable; this could be several months into the new year. Project completion on this segment is expected in 2023.
